1// Edit a monitor returns "OK" response
2use datadog_api_client::datadog;
3use datadog_api_client::datadogV1::api_monitors::MonitorsAPI;
4use datadog_api_client::datadogV1::model::MonitorOptions;
5use datadog_api_client::datadogV1::model::MonitorThresholds;
6use datadog_api_client::datadogV1::model::MonitorUpdateRequest;
7
8#[tokio::main]
9async fn main() {
10    // there is a valid "monitor" in the system
11    let monitor_id: i64 = std::env::var("MONITOR_ID").unwrap().parse().unwrap();
12    let body = MonitorUpdateRequest::new()
13        .name("My monitor-updated".to_string())
14        .options(
15            MonitorOptions::new()
16                .evaluation_delay(None)
17                .new_group_delay(Some(600))
18                .new_host_delay(None)
19                .renotify_interval(None)
20                .thresholds(MonitorThresholds::new().critical(2.0 as f64).warning(None))
21                .timeout_h(None),
22        )
23        .priority(None);
24    let configuration = datadog::Configuration::new();
25    let api = MonitorsAPI::with_config(configuration);
26    let resp = api.update_monitor(monitor_id.clone(), body).await;
27    if let Ok(value) = resp {
28        println!("{:#?}", value);
29    } else {
30        println!("{:#?}", resp.unwrap_err());
31    }
32}
